## Authentication

Heads up, support folks: the Crumblenote consent banner rollout is gated behind the internal Flagpost service, so the banner config dashboard needs a key to load tenant settings. Without it you'll just see a blank panel, not an error — annoying, we know. Rotation is handled by the platform crew monthly. Paste the key into the dashboard's settings pane. Current key:

API key for yahig-tadup: kto7_ubizbYm

## Data stores: the bloom filter

Heads up before you review the lookup path in Quillcache: we keep a bloom filter in front of the key-value store so we can skip disk reads for keys that definitely don't exist. False positives are fine (~1%), false negatives are impossible, so don't add a second existence check after the filter — it's redundant. The filter rebuilds nightly from the keyspace snapshot. If you want to poke at the backing store yourself, connect with the string below.

primary connection of kagug-bahip = postgresql://rusiel_svc:en4yBjxJZ4J3AT@db-25fa.urlaqcorp.corp:5432/holok

Handover: Fernhouse controller, bays 3–5. Humidity sensors drift upward ~2% per week; firmware applies a rolling recalibration every 72h. Relevant to your review: the calibration endpoint accepts unsigned payloads from the LAN — flagged, not yet fixed. Mitigation is a VLAN ACL, details in the ticket. Drift compensation itself is pure math, no external calls. Do not disable recalibration during the audit; bay 4 will overshoot. Calibration logs and the ACL config are documented on the internal page here.

runbook for badug-kadup: https://confluence.zemvarlabs.internal/projects/browse/display/projects/bd1b